Verspreide huizen Anjum is located in the province of Friesland, in the municipality of Noardeast-Fryslân, in the district Anjum - Noordoost The neighbourhood has a total area of 1.940 hectares, of which 1.871 hectares are land and 69 hectares are water. The neighbourhood is coded as BU19700307. The postcode area is 9133DH-9133NH.
Verspreide huizen Anjum has 185 residents. Of these, 56,8% are men and 45,9% are women. Most residents are 45 to 65 years (35,1%). The other age groups are 18,9% for '25 to 45 years', 18,9% for '65 years or older', 13,5% for '0 to 15 years' and 10,8% for '15 to 25 years'. Of the residents, 45,9% is unmarried, 43,2% is married and 8,1% is divorced. 170 residents originate from the Netherlands, 10 come from Europe and 5 come from countries outside Europe.
There are 75 households in Verspreide huizen Anjum. 33,3% of these are single-person households, 33,3% households without children and 33,3% households with children. The average household size is 2,4 persons.
In Verspreide huizen Anjum there are 200 income recipients. The average income per income recipient is €35.000, which is €800 (2%) lower than the national average of €35.800. Per resident, the average income is €29.900, which is €700 (2%) higher than the national average of €29.200. Most residents of Verspreide huizen Anjum are educated to an intermediate level. 58,8% have an intermediate education (HAVO, VWO or MBO 2-4), 23,5% have a university or higher professional education (HBO/WO) and 17,6% have a lower education (VMBO or MBO 1).
Of the 185 residents, around 76% are in paid employment, which amounts to 141 people. This is 11% higher than the national average of 65%. In Verspreide huizen Anjum, 22% of residents receive a benefit. The largest group is those receiving a state pension (AOW). 30 people receive this benefit.
In Verspreide huizen Anjum there are 81 homes with an average assessed value (WOZ) of €385.000. Of these, around 90% are occupied and 10% unoccupied. Most homes are owner-occupied. This amounts to 15% rental homes and 85% owner-occupied homes. Of the homes, 85% privately owned and 15% owned by other landlords. The most common construction periods in Verspreide huizen Anjum are 1700-1900 (37%) and 1900-1925 (13%).

In Verspreide huizen Anjum there are 85 addresses with a registered energy label. The most common labels are G (53%), D (13%) and A (12%). On average, an address in Verspreide huizen Anjum uses 3.820 kWh of electricity per year. This is 36% above the national average of 2.810 kWh. Natural gas consumption, at 1.560 m³ per year, is 22% above the national average of 1.280 m³.

From Verspreide huizen Anjum you can on average reach a supermarket at 1.8 km, a GP at 1.6 km, a railway station at 16.3 km, a primary school at 1.6 km (as the crow flies, source: CBS).
